Compound: Tris(3,5-bis(trifluoromethyl)phenyl)phosphine, is researched, Molecular C24H9F18P, CAS is 175136-62-6, about Carbon Dioxide as a Solubility “”Switch”” for the Reversible Dissolution of Highly Fluorinated Complexes and Reagents in Organic Solvents: Application to Crystallization. Author is Jessop, Philip G.; Olmstead, Marilyn M.; Ablan, Christopher D.; Grabenauer, Megan; Sheppard, Daniel; Eckert, Charles A.; Liotta, Charles L..
Highly fluorinated organic or organometallic solid compounds can be made to dissolve in liquid hydrocarbons by the application of 20-70 bar of CO2 gas. Subsequently releasing the gas causes the compounds to precipitate or crystallize, giving quant. recovery of the solid. The resulting crystals can be of sufficient quality for single-crystal x-ray crystallog.; the structures of Rh2(O2CCF2CF2CF3)4(DMF)2, Rh2(O2C(CF2)9F)4(MeOH)2, Cr(hfacac)3, and P{C6H3(3,5-CF3)2}3 were determined from crystals grown in this manner.
